The Emergence and Essence of Asset On-Chain Liquidity

In the ever-evolving world of digital finance, one concept stands out for its transformative potential and revolutionary impact: Asset On-Chain Liquidity. As blockchain technology continues to redefine traditional financial paradigms, this innovative approach to liquidity provision is reshaping the landscape of asset management.

The Genesis of On-Chain Liquidity

At its core, Asset On-Chain Liquidity refers to the ability to trade, borrow, and lend digital assets directly on the blockchain without relying on traditional intermediaries. This concept is the bedrock of decentralized finance (DeFi), an ecosystem built on open protocols and smart contracts that facilitate peer-to-peer transactions.

Imagine a world where liquidity is not confined to centralized exchanges but flows seamlessly across the blockchain. In this new paradigm, assets can be traded, borrowed, and lent directly within the blockchain network, fostering a more efficient and decentralized financial ecosystem.

The Mechanics of On-Chain Liquidity

On-chain liquidity is primarily facilitated through decentralized exchanges (DEXs) and liquidity pools. These pools, powered by smart contracts, allow users to provide liquidity to various trading pairs. By contributing their assets, liquidity providers enable others to trade without the need for a central authority.

The magic of on-chain liquidity lies in its utilization of smart contracts. These self-executing contracts automatically manage liquidity provision, trade execution, and lending operations. This automation not only reduces the need for intermediaries but also enhances security and transparency.

The Benefits of On-Chain Liquidity

Decentralization and Control: On-chain liquidity empowers users with greater control over their assets. By providing liquidity directly on the blockchain, users retain ownership and custody of their assets while earning rewards for their contribution. This level of control is a stark departure from traditional finance, where intermediaries often hold custody of users' assets.

Accessibility and Inclusivity: On-chain liquidity democratizes access to financial services. Regardless of geographic location or financial background, anyone with an internet connection can participate in liquidity provision. This inclusivity fosters a more diverse and global financial ecosystem.

Liquidity and Market Efficiency: By enabling direct trading and lending, on-chain liquidity enhances market efficiency. Liquidity pools ensure that there are always assets available for trading, reducing the risk of market disruptions and slippage. This liquidity is crucial for the smooth functioning of decentralized markets.

Innovative Financial Products: On-chain liquidity is the foundation for a myriad of innovative financial products. From decentralized lending and borrowing platforms to yield farming and staking, the possibilities are vast and ever-expanding. These products offer users new ways to generate passive income and optimize their asset portfolios.

Innovative Financial Products and Services

The potential of on-chain liquidity extends beyond asset management and market efficiency. It serves as the foundation for a wide array of innovative financial products and services. These products are designed to optimize asset utilization, generate passive income, and provide new investment opportunities.

Decentralized Lending and Borrowing: Platforms like Aave and Compound enable users to lend their assets and earn interest or borrow assets against collateral. This decentralized lending and borrowing ecosystem operates on smart contracts, ensuring secure and transparent transactions.

Yield Farming and Staking: Yield farming and staking are innovative ways to generate passive income from on-chain liquidity. Users can provide liquidity to various pools and earn rewards in the form of governance tokens or interest. These activities contribute to the health of decentralized networks while providing users with a new source of income.

Decentralized Insurance: Decentralized insurance platforms leverage on-chain liquidity to provide coverage for various risks. Smart contracts automate claims processing and payouts, ensuring secure and transparent insurance services.

Decentralized Autonomous Organizations (DAOs): DAOs are decentralized organizations governed by smart contracts. They leverage on-chain liquidity to manage assets, make decisions, and execute transactions. DAOs offer a new model for organizational governance and decision-making.

Challenges and Considerations

While the potential of Asset On-Chain Liquidity is immense, it is not without challenges. The following considerations are crucial for the continued growth and development of this innovative concept:

Security Risks: The use of smart contracts introduces potential security risks. Bugs, vulnerabilities, and hacks can compromise the integrity of on-chain liquidity protocols. Robust security measures, audits, and continuous monitoring are essential to mitigate these risks.

Regulatory Compliance: As on-chain liquidity gains traction, regulatory compliance becomes increasingly important. Ensuring that decentralized platforms adhere to relevant regulations while fostering innovation is a complex challenge.

Scalability: As the number of users and transactions on decentralized networks grows, scalability becomes a critical concern. Layer 2 solutions, cross-chain interoperability, and advancements in blockchain technology will be essential to address scalability issues.

User Education and Adoption: For on-chain liquidity to reach its full potential, widespread user education and adoption are crucial. Educating users about the benefits and risks of decentralized finance will be essential to drive mainstream adoption.

Advanced Liquidity Protocols

The evolution of advanced liquidity protocols will be crucial for the future of on-chain liquidity. These protocols will incorporate features like automated market makers (AMMs), decentralized oracles, and risk management tools to optimize liquidity provision.

For example, decentralized exchanges can leverage AMMs to provide liquidity without the need for order books. AMMs use smart contracts to automatically match buy and sell orders, ensuring efficient liquidity provision. Advanced liquidity protocols will also incorporate decentralized oracles to provide real-time data and ensure accurate pricing.

The implications for investment are profound. Blockchain enables the tokenization of real-world assets, turning everything from real estate and art to stocks and bonds into digital tokens that can be traded on blockchain platforms. This process, known as tokenization, offers several advantages. It can increase liquidity for traditionally illiquid assets, allow for fractional ownership, making high-value assets accessible to a wider range of investors, and streamline the entire process of buying, selling, and managing these assets. Imagine owning a small fraction of a valuable piece of art or a commercial property, managed and traded seamlessly through blockchain technology. This democratizes access to investment opportunities that were previously out of reach for many.

Smart contracts are another key innovation powering these new financial opportunities. These are self-executing contracts with the terms of the agreement directly written into code. They automatically execute actions when predefined conditions are met, without the need for intermediaries. In finance, smart contracts can automate everything from dividend payouts and interest payments to insurance claims and escrow services. This not only increases efficiency and reduces costs but also minimizes the potential for human error and disputes, ensuring that agreements are executed precisely as intended.

The development of stablecoins, cryptocurrencies pegged to a stable asset like the US dollar, further bridges the gap between traditional finance and the blockchain world. Stablecoins offer the benefits of cryptocurrency transactions – speed, low fees, and global accessibility – without the extreme price volatility often associated with other cryptocurrencies. They are becoming increasingly vital for everyday transactions, as a store of value within the crypto ecosystem, and as a bridge for moving capital into and out of decentralized applications.

The transformative power of blockchain extends beyond mere financial transactions; it's fundamentally reimagining ownership, investment, and the very infrastructure of financial markets. The advent of Non-Fungible Tokens (NFTs) is a prime example of this paradigm shift. While fungible tokens (like cryptocurrencies) are interchangeable, NFTs are unique digital assets, each with its own distinct identity and ownership record on the blockchain. Initially gaining traction in the art and collectibles world, NFTs are now finding applications in areas like digital identity, ticketing, and even real estate, offering verifiable proof of ownership for digital and increasingly, physical assets. This has opened up entirely new markets and revenue streams for creators and owners, allowing for novel ways to monetize digital content and unique assets.

The implications for institutional finance are equally compelling. Blockchain offers the potential to streamline complex back-office operations, reduce settlement times for securities trading from days to minutes, and enhance the security and transparency of financial record-keeping. Companies are exploring the use of blockchain for everything from trade finance and supply chain management to digital identity verification and regulatory compliance. The ability to create a single, auditable source of truth can significantly reduce operational costs, minimize errors, and improve overall efficiency within large financial organizations.

Consider the traditional process of issuing and trading securities. It involves multiple intermediaries, extensive paperwork, and lengthy settlement periods. Blockchain technology can facilitate the tokenization of securities, creating digital representations of stocks, bonds, and other financial instruments. These tokenized securities can then be traded on blockchain-based platforms, enabling faster, cheaper, and more transparent transactions. This also opens the door for more granular and accessible investment opportunities, such as fractional ownership of traditionally high-value assets, and the creation of entirely new types of financial instruments.

The concept of a decentralized autonomous organization (DAO) is another innovative application of blockchain that is impacting financial governance and investment. DAOs are organizations whose rules are encoded as smart contracts on a blockchain, with decisions made through a consensus mechanism involving token holders. This allows for transparent, community-driven governance and is being used to manage investment funds, decentralized protocols, and even creative projects. DAOs offer a new model for collective investment and decision-making, empowering communities to pool resources and collectively manage assets with unprecedented transparency and democratic participation.

The energy sector is also beginning to explore blockchain's potential. Beyond its use in managing energy grids and facilitating peer-to-peer energy trading, blockchain can also be used to create transparent and verifiable carbon credit markets. By tokenizing carbon credits on a blockchain, companies can more easily track, trade, and retire them, ensuring greater accountability and preventing double-counting. This offers a powerful tool for combating climate change and promoting sustainable practices.

Data security and privacy are paramount in finance, and blockchain offers innovative solutions. While public blockchains are transparent, private and permissioned blockchains can offer controlled access to sensitive information. Advanced cryptographic techniques, such as zero-knowledge proofs, are being developed to enable transactions and verifications on the blockchain without revealing the underlying data, thus enhancing privacy while maintaining security and auditability. This is crucial for industries dealing with highly sensitive personal and financial information.
